Economy & Jobs

The median household income in North Ridgeville is $94,234, 25% above the national average of $75,149. Residents generally enjoy above-average earning potential. The job market is very strong with unemployment at just 1.9%. Only 3.6% of residents live below the poverty line, well below the national rate of 12.4%. Workers commute an average of 26 minutes.

Cost of Living & Housing

The median home value in North Ridgeville is $254,700, 10% below the national median / offering relatively affordable homeownership. Renters pay a median of $1,067 per month. At just 2.7x median income, home prices are very affordable relative to local earnings.

Safety & Crime

North Ridgeville is a very safe community with a violent crime rate of 38 per 100,000 residents / well below the national average of 380. Property crime occurs at a rate of 325 per 100,000, 83% below the national average.

Education

Educational attainment is solid, with 34.9% holding a bachelor's degree or higher, near the national average. 96.2% have completed high school. Area schools have an average test score of 5.9/10.

Climate & Weather

North Ridgeville experiences four distinct seasons with an average temperature of 53°F. Winters average 29°F in January while summers reach 75°F in July. With 275 sunny days per year, residents enjoy well above the national average of sunshine. Annual precipitation totals 42.0 inches, including 43.6 inches of snow. Air quality is rated Good with a median AQI of 43.

North Ridgeville has a population of 36,043 with a density of 1,538 people per square mile, spread across 23.6 square miles. The median age is 41.0 years, 5% older than the national median of 38.9. The gender split is 49.5% female and 50.5% male. The city is predominantly White (88.8%), with 2.4% Black. English is the primary language spoken at home by 94.9% of residents, while 5.1% speak Spanish. 8.5% of the population are veterans, above the national rate of 6.0%. 12.4% of residents have a disability. 96.3% have health insurance coverage.

The median household income in North Ridgeville is $94,234, which is 25% above the national average of $75,149. Per capita income is $45,155 (above the $39,052 national figure). The average weekly wage is $1,072, 25% lower than the U.S. average. The unemployment rate is 1.9% (below the 3.6% US average). 3.6% of residents live below the poverty line, lower than the national rate of 12.4%. The area has 6,969 business establishments, including 542 restaurants. The cost of living index is 92.8, below the national baseline of 100 / offering relatively affordable living. Workers commute an average of 26 minutes. 13.3% of workers work from home.

The median home value in North Ridgeville is $254,700, 10% below the national median of $281,900. Zillow estimates the typical home value at $319,443, higher than the Census estimate. Homes sell for 99.4% of their list price. Monthly rent averages $1,067 (8% below the national average of $1,163). Fair market rent ranges from $873 for a one-bedroom to $1,092 for a two-bedroom apartment. 89.9% of housing units are owner-occupied (above the 65.4% national rate). There are 14,026 total housing units in the city. The median year a home was built is 1993. The average annual property tax is $6,154 (higher than the $3,500 national average). 25.9% of renters spend 30% or more of their income on housing. The home price-to-income ratio is 2.7x, well within the affordable range.

In North Ridgeville, 33.3% of adults are obese, above the national rate of 32.1%. 9.4% have diabetes. Heart disease affects 5.0% of residents. 30.2% have high blood pressure. 12.5% are current smokers. 19.4% report binge drinking. 22.2% are physically inactive. 26.5% report depression (above the 20.0% national average). 17.7% experience frequent mental distress. 6.4% of residents lack health insurance (below the 8.6% national rate). The primary care physician ratio is 1:1,936. The dentist ratio is 1:2,040. 95.1% of residents have access to exercise opportunities. The food environment index is 7.6 out of 10.

North Ridgeville experiences four distinct seasons with an average annual temperature of 53°F (11°C). Winters average 29°F in January while summers reach 75°F in July. The area gets 275 sunny days per year, well above the U.S. average of 205 / making it one of the sunnier locations in the country. Annual precipitation totals 42.0 inches. The area receives 43.6 inches of snow annually, making winter weather a significant factor for residents. Air quality is rated Good with a median AQI of 43. The city sits at an elevation of 732 feet.
